Exploring research trends in cancer immunotherapy via single-cell technologies: a scientometric perspective
IntroductionCancer immunotherapy has brought new therapeutic hopes for cancer patients, but it is complex in its mechanism of action, and there are significant individual differences, which restricts its wide use.
